On Fri, Apr 26, 2013 at 4:04 PM, Jonathan Ludlam < [email protected]> wrote: > > > Sent from my iPad > > On 26 Apr 2013, at 20:57, "[email protected]" <[email protected]> wrote: > > So the proper way to do this would be, > > xe pool-emergency-transition-to-master > xe pool-recover-slaves > > xe host-list params=uuid,name-label,host-metrics-live > > xe vm-reset-powerstate resident-on=UUID-OF-FAILED-MASTER --force --multiple > > /opt/xensource/sm/resetvdis.py NEW-POOl-MASTER-UUID SR-UUID master > > > I believe that should be the uuid of the old failed master, not the new > ones, and you should do this for each SR the master had attached. > > Jon > > ? > > > On Fri, Apr 26, 2013 at 3:43 PM, Jonathan Ludlam < > [email protected]> wrote: > >> No, the fix is to run the scrip 'resetvdis.py' - see this bit of the >> xenserver docs: >> http://docs.vmd.citrix.com/XenServer/6.1.0/1.0/en_gb/reference.html#pool_failures >> >> This is not obvious, but has been made better in the version of xapi >> under development at the moment, so in the next release it ought to be a >> bit smoother. >> >> Jon >> >> Sent from my iPad >> >> On 26 Apr 2013, at 19:16, "[email protected]" <[email protected]> wrote: >> >> Hello, >> >> I had a master of the pool fail. I did the following on the slave in the >> pool, >> >> xe pool-emergency-transition-to-master >> xe pool-recover-slaves >> >> xe host-list params=uuid,name-label,host-metrics-live >> >> xe vm-reset-powerstate resident-on=UUID-OF-FAILED-MASTER --force >> --multiple >> >> now when I try to start a VM on the old slave that is now the master, I >> get the following, >> >> Error code: SR_BACKEND_FAILURE_46 >> Error parameters: , The VDI is not available [opterr=VDI >> b4354ed7-3042-4874-93b4-59a392c43027 already attached RW], >> >> I'd tried everything I can find online to fix this, the only way I'd been >> able to fix the important VMs was to vdi-forget them, then relabel/readd >> them to the VMs and start. That works, but is that REALLY the only way to >> fix this problem? >> >> Also the VDIs were created shared, however, they are showing false under >> xe commands. >> >> Any insight? >> >> _______________________________________________ >> Xen-api mailing list >> [email protected] >> http://lists.xen.org/cgi-bin/mailman/listinfo/xen-api >> >> >
